Abstract

The present application discloses a humidification and purification apparatus, which includes: a machine body provided with an air inlet and an air outlet; a purification and humidification module disposed in the machine body and close to the air inlet; and a blower disposed in the machine body and close to the air outlet. The purification and humidification module includes: a humidification module including a wet pad water tank, a wet pad and an elevation mechanism. The elevation mechanism is connected to the wet pad and is configured to drive the wet pad to move, and the humidification module can be switched between a humidifying state and a non-humidifying state. In the humidifying state, part of the wet pad is immersed into the water in the wet pad water tank, and in the non-humidifying state, the wet pad is lifted above the water level of the wet pad water tank.

Abstract

An air duct assembly for an axial flow fan including an air inlet shroud and an air outlet shroud. The air inlet shroud includes a plurality of mutually angled air inlet surfaces, and a ratio of an area of the air inlet surfaces of the air inlet shroud to that of air outlet surfaces of the air outlet shroud is 1.1 to 1.35. The air inlet shroud is provided to have mutually angled air inlet surfaces to increase the ratio of the area of the air inlet surfaces of the air inlet shroud to that of the air outlet surfaces of the air outlet shroud, obtaining a higher wind speed with fairly little noise.

Abstract

A fan control method is described. The method includes obtaining, after controlling a fan to enter a scene wind running mode, the sleep time of a particular user corresponding to the scene wind running mode, obtaining a gear control time sequence of the fan according to the sleep time of the particular user, and controlling the fan according to the gear control time sequence of the fan to adjust the wind speed of the fan. The method can provide gentler wind during sleep of particular users such as babies and pregnant women to prevent the users from catching a cold, and also can provide a quitter sleep environment for babies and pregnant women to improve their sleep quality.

Abstract

A fan, and a control system and method therefor, wherein the system comprises a wearable device (100) and a fan (200). The fan (200) communicates with the wearable device (100). The wearable device (100) is used for detecting body parameters of a user to determine whether the user falls asleep, generating a sleep wind mode instruction to the fan (200). The fan (200) enters a sleep wind mode after receiving the sleep wind mode instruction, obtains a sleep wind control curve, and adjusts operating parameters according to the sleep wind control curve. The fan control system can adjust the running gear of the fan according to the sleep wind control curve after the user falls asleep, and avoids interference factors, thereby improving the control precision of the fan and improving user experience.

Abstract

A rear guard of a box fan comprises: a body arranged vertically and a waterproof part arranged on the body. The waterproof part is arranged in a position corresponding to a motor in the box fan and the waterproof part comprises a plurality of recessed structures arranged on the body. a plurality of vent holes are arranged on the body for communicating an inner side of the body with an outer side of the body are arranged in the recessed structures. By arranging the vent holes in the recessed structures, the waterproof effect is realized on the premise of ensuring ventilation, the electric leakage and ignition of the motor can be effectively prevented, and the lifetime of the motor of the box fan is extended.

Abstract

Disclosed are a fan head part, a stand fan and a wall-mounted fan, a household appliance and an air blowing method. The fan head part comprises a base and a fan head, wherein the fan head comprises a blade and a grill, the blade being able to rotate with a first axis, the fan head being able to integrally rotate about a second axis and along a circumferential direction relative to the base, and the second axis extends through the grill in the front-rear direction and being obliquely arranged relative to the first axis. Since the second axis is obliquely arranged relative to the first axis, only one driving structure is required to simultaneously drive the fan head to rotate within a space defined in the horizontal and vertical directions, so that the structure is simple, and the costs are relatively low.
